The berserker is B-A-A-A-C-C-K
Critic comment I seem to start off my critiques of Moulton by saying it is the kind of thing I do not care for, then saying it was quite readable. Moulton tends to a certain triteness in his writings, but overcomes that with the concept and other presentation. One would think that a story about a berserk military machine would be one of those juvenile special-effects things with no other content and a plot that is weak to non-existent. That is not the case here. It was actually rather a fun read. Moulton does use fun as a basic part of his writing. BEL *** ½
